Co-op City Rent Report — January 2014

Asking rents in ZIP 10475, New York City, from 56 listings.

Median 2BR rent in Co-op City was $1,370 in January 2014. The middle half of 2BR listings asked between $1,250 and $1,370. That puts Co-op City $430 below the New York City citywide 2BR median of $1,800. The month's figures are based on 56 listings across 7 bedroom categories.
